WebJul 16, 2013 · This study has revealed that the twin resting cysts are formed inside the secondary lunate sporangium (Fig. 2F–J). The pair of twin resting cysts receives 1/8 of the lipid reserves of the infected copepod egg. A host infection could provide 8 lunate sporangia and the subsequent 8 pairs (16 cells) of resting cysts.
